Theatre Assistant Practitioner
£17.10ph London
Theatre Assistant Practitioner to work with patients in Anaesthetics, Theatre or Recovery (Adult or Paediatric).
Ref: TH1/C4
You will support a theatre team in the care of patients prior to and during surgery, clean and prepare theatre equipment and instruments used for surgical procedures, assists surgical medical staff for minor surgical procedures, observe patients condition, record clinical observations and report to line manager.
You will be required to have a knowledge of theatre procedures / protocols including surgical assistance, clinical observations acquired through NVQ level 3 plus further training and experience in theatres OR equivalent. At least 2 years theatre experience in the area of the assignment is needed. An NVQ Assessor is desirable but not required.
